Operation
Calling Your Mailbox
To call your mailbox:
With a multiline terminal, your Voice Mail key flashes green and your Message Center keys flash red
when they have messages waiting. If you do not have a Voice Mail key, your Message Waiting LED
flashes instead.
Multiline Terminal
1. Press your Voice Mail key (PRG 15-07 or SC 751: 01 + 8).
- OR -
Press the Vmsg softkey.
- OR -
Press the Message key on the telephone, if equipped.
Your mailbox number is normally the same as your extension number. You may optionally dial a co-workers
mailbox - or use this procedure to call your mailbox from a co-workers telephone.
- OR -
Press Speaker and dial 8.
2. If requested by Voice Mail, enter your security code.
Ask your Voice Mail system administrator for your security code.
Normally, your Message Waiting (MW) LED goes out (if applicable). If it continues to flash, you have
unanswered Message Waiting requests or a new General Message. Go to To check your messages below.
Single Line Telephone
1. Lift the handset and dial 8.
If you are at a co-workers telephone, you can dial the Voice Mail master number and your mailbox number
instead. You can also use this procedure from your own telephone to call a co-workers mailbox.
2. If requested by Voice Mail, enter your security code.
